Where is the Potopa family from?

You can see how Potopa families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Potopa family name was found in the USA in 1920. In 1920 there was 1 Potopa family living in Illinois. This was about 50% of all the recorded Potopa's in USA. Illinois and 1 other state had the highest population of Potopa families in 1920.

What is the average Potopa lifespan?

Between 1944 and 2001, in the United States, Potopa life expectancy was at its lowest point in 1944, and highest in 1999. The average life expectancy for Potopa in 1944 was 28, and 74 in 2001.

An unusually short lifespan might indicate that your Potopa ancestors lived in harsh conditions. A short lifespan might also indicate health problems that were once prevalent in your family.
